优草派  >   Python

python char类型

黄佳怡            来源:优草派

在Python中,Char类型是一个非常重要的数据类型。Char类型是指一个字符,它可以是数字、字母或符号等。在Python中,我们可以使用单引号或双引号来表示Char类型。Char类型在Python中的表现形式是一个字符串,它可以被用来表示一个单独的字符或一个字符串。在本文中,我们将从多个角度分析Python中的Char类型。

1. Char类型的概念

python char类型

在计算机编程中,Char类型是指字符类型。在Python中,Char类型是一种字符串类型,它可以包含一个或多个字符。Char类型在Python中是不可变的,这意味着一旦创建,它的值不能被改变。但是,我们可以通过拼接两个Char类型的字符串来创建一个新的Char类型。

2. Char类型的使用

在Python中,我们可以使用单引号或双引号来表示Char类型。下面是一些Char类型的示例。

```python

ch1 = 'a'

ch2 = "b"

ch3 = '$'

```

上面的代码中,ch1、ch2、ch3分别表示字符'a'、字符'b'和符号'$'。我们可以通过print语句来输出这些字符。

```python

print(ch1)

print(ch2)

print(ch3)

```

输出结果为:

```python

a

b

$

```

我们还可以将多个Char类型拼接起来来创建一个新的Char类型。下面是一个示例代码:

```python

ch4 = ch1 + ch2 + ch3

print(ch4)

```

输出结果为:

```python

ab$

```

3. Char类型的转换

在Python中,Char类型可以通过ord()函数将字符转换为ASCII码,也可以通过chr()函数将ASCII码转换为字符。下面是一个示例代码:

```python

ch5 = 'A'

print(ord(ch5))

num = 65

print(chr(num))

```

输出结果为:

```python

65

A

```

4. Char类型的比较

在Python中,我们可以使用==、<、>等比较运算符来比较两个Char类型的字符串。当两个字符串相等时,比较运算符返回True,否则返回False。下面是一个示例代码:

```python

ch6 = 'abc'

ch7 = 'xyz'

ch8 = 'abc'

print(ch6 == ch7)

print(ch6 == ch8)

print(ch6 < ch7)

```

输出结果为:

```python

False

True

True

```

5. Char类型的应用

在Python中,Char类型在很多地方都得到了广泛的应用。比如,在字符串处理中,我们经常需要对一个字符串进行分割、替换、排序等操作,这些操作都需要用到Char类型。此外,在图像处理、文本处理、数据分析等领域,Char类型也得到了广泛的应用。

6. 总结

Python中的Char类型是一种非常重要的数据类型,它可以表示一个字符或一个字符串。Char类型在Python中是不可变的,它可以通过拼接两个Char类型的字符串来创建一个新的Char类型。在Python中,我们可以使用ord()函数将字符转换为ASCII码,也可以通过chr()函数将ASCII码转换为字符。Char类型在字符串处理、图像处理、文本处理、数据分析等领域得到了广泛的应用。

7.

【关键词】Python、Char类型、字符串、不可变、ASCII码、比较运算符、应用

【原创声明】凡注明“来源:优草派”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。
TOP 10
  • 周排行
  • 月排行